The tech you get
An OCLV Mountain Carbon frame with a 4-way Mino Link lower shock mount for tweaking geometry and suspension leverage rate. A 130mm fork, plus 120mm of rear travel from a Fox Factory Float. Shimano's all-new XTR Di2 12-speed drivetrain, Shimano XTR M9220 hydraulic brakes, Bontrager Line dropper post, and tubeless-ready Bontrager Line Pro 30 OCLV Carbon wheels.
